The shooter who killed six people at Covenant School in Nashville, Tennessee has been identified as 28-year-old Audrey Hale. But let’s look a little deeper. The Washington Post reports that Rep. Andy Ogles, who represents Nashville, can be seen in a 2021 photo holding firearms along with his family.

https://twitter.com/postpolitics/status/1640448352658530310

Nice how they put “heartbroken” in quotation marks. No, seriously, this is an actual story WaPo wrote up:

Rep. Andrew Ogles (R-Tenn.), who represents the Nashville district where the Covenant School is located, said Monday in a statement that he was “utterly heartbroken” by the shooting that left six people dead, including three children.

Gun-control advocates and Democrats highlighted another post from Ogles — a 2021 Christmas photo of his family posing with firearms.

On Monday, Ogles’s critics shared the congressman’s statement about the shooting along with the Christmas photo.

“How much more bloodshed will it take?” Rep. Veronica Escobar (D-Tex.) wrote in a tweet featuring Ogles’s photo. “It’s. The. Guns.”

Fred Guttenberg, who advocates for gun control after his 14-year-daughter, Jaime, was killed in the Parkland school shooting in 2018, said the tragedy “is listening to Tennessee politicians who refuse to call it a shooting but who engaged in behavior that caused this to be more likely when they glorify guns.”
